connect MetaMask to site

Published: 2026-05-17 18:10:10

Connecting MetaMask to a Website: A Step-by-Step Guide

MetaMask is a popular Ethereum wallet that allows users to interact directly with decentralized applications (dApps) and blockchain networks on the Ethereum network. With its user-friendly interface, it enables users to store cryptocurrencies like Ether (ETH) and other ERC20 tokens securely, send transactions, and even build dApps of their own using web3 technology. Connecting MetaMask to a website, whether it's a gaming platform, marketplace, or any other service built on Ethereum, opens up a world of possibilities for engaging in decentralized financial applications (DeFi), governance, and more.

In this guide, we will walk you through the step-by-step process of connecting MetaMask to a website, ensuring that your wallet is properly integrated so you can start exploring the blockchain ecosystem seamlessly.

Step 1: Install MetaMask

Firstly, if you haven't already, download and install the MetaMask extension on your web browser. You can visit metamask.io/download for Chrome or any other supported browsers to initiate this step.

Step 2: Login with Your Existing Account

Once installed, click on the MetaMask icon in your browser’s toolbar. If you already have a MetaMask account connected to your Ethereum address (also known as a wallet), simply log in with your existing credentials or by clicking 'Import Key' if this is your first time using MetaMask.

Step 3: Enable MetaMask on the Website

After opening the dApp of choice – let’s say an online gaming platform you wish to interact with – you will likely encounter a prompt asking for permission to connect. This typically appears as "Add Network" or "Use MetaMask" and is crucial in connecting your browser's MetaMask wallet directly with the specific Ethereum network (e.g., Mainnet, Ropsten) that the website operates on.

Click 'Use MetaMask' or 'Add Network' to proceed. You will then be presented with a pop-up window showing different networks. Select the correct chain ID for the Ethereum network your dApp runs on. For instance, if it’s on Mainnet, choose "Mainnet" and accept its RPC (Remote Procedure Call) URL. If you are unsure of which network to select, check the website's documentation or consult with a developer since choosing incorrectly can lead to errors in transactions.

Step 4: Add Your MetaMask Wallet

After confirming the correct chain ID for your desired Ethereum network, you will be asked to connect and authorize access to the game platform by selecting "Approve" from the pop-up options. This action grants permission to the website to interact with your wallet's private keys (which are stored securely in MetaMask) on behalf of the user.

Step 5: Confirm Your Transaction or Action

Once MetaMask is connected, you can proceed with making transactions or taking actions within the game platform as required. Remember that all interactions will be charged a transaction fee and involve gas costs to get confirmed by miners, so ensure your account balance covers these expenses. If unsure about the gas limit or cost, consult the dApp for guidance or set it according to MetaMask's suggestion.

Step 6: Finalize Your Action

After confirming the gas price and amount in Ether or any other token you are transacting with, complete your action (e.g., purchase an item, enter a game level) by clicking "Confirm" or similar transaction confirmation buttons.

In conclusion, connecting MetaMask to a website is a straightforward process that empowers users to engage with the decentralized world of applications and blockchain transactions. Whether you are new to Ethereum or have had some experience, this guide ensures your MetaMask setup is seamless and ready for exploring and participating in the vibrant ecosystem of Ethereum dApps.

Remember to always ensure the security of your wallet by not sharing login credentials, enabling two-factor authentication if available, and regularly checking for updates and patches from MetaMask's side. The future of decentralized applications relies on secure connections like these, fostering trustless interactions across a wide range of digital services powered by blockchain technology.

Recommended for You

🔥 Recommended Platforms